Anime On Netflix Is Way More Popular Than You Might Realize
The AnimeJapan 2022 event–the largest anime convention in Japan–revealed a significant surge in anime viewing around the world in 2021. As reported by Variety, Netflix shared that over half of the streaming service’s users watched anime last year.

Warhammer 40,000- Shootas, Blood, & Teef Swaps Gangsters For Orks
This week’s Warhammer Skulls Showcase had a lot of content to show off, most of which has been carried by the power-armoured shoulders of the Space Marines who exist in that grim and dark universe. For Warhammer 40K fans looking for a different and greener type of action, there is an alternative on the way in the form of everyone’s favourite green-skinned war boys, the Orks.

Wynn Macau Limited officially applies for new Macau gambling concession
Asian casino operator Wynn Macau Limited has reportedly applied for a new ten-year license that would give it official permission to continue offering gambling entertainment at its pair of Macau properties until the end of 2033.
According to a report from Inside Asian Gaming, the firm majority-owned by American casino operator Wynn Resorts Limited has run the former Portuguese enclave’s 1,000-room Wynn Macau property since 2006 and debuted its even larger Wynn Palace Cotai venue some six years ago.
